精华内容
下载资源
问答
  • Matlab将Excel表格数据导入并绘制曲线一般流程常见问题 一般流程 准备一个已有数据的Excel表格,一般格式为 xlsx 格式; 打开Matlab,点击菜单栏中的导入数据,选择准备好的Excel表格; 在弹出的Matlab窗口的菜单...

    用Matlab将Excel表格数据导入并绘制曲线

    一般流程

    1. 准备一个已有数据的Excel表格,一般格式为 xlsx 格式;
    2. 打开Matlab,点击菜单栏中的导入数据,选择准备好的Excel表格;
    3. 在弹出的Matlab窗口的菜单栏里选择导入的范围,导入格式为列矢量,然后点击导入数据;
    4. 在Matlab主页工作空间窗口可以看到导入的数据变量,在这里可以右击重命名;
    5. 最后在Matlab主页命令区域,属于下列命令进行图像绘制:
    plot(time,data1,'r-');
    hold on;
    plot(time,date2,'b-.');
    xlabel('data1/s');
    ylabel('data2/m');
    
    • 注:绘制好的曲线可以在弹出的图像窗口中,选择文件,另存为,进行保存方便后续图像加工。

    常见问题

    • Ubuntu系统导出的Excel文件在Windows系统下重新保存
    • 报错:当导入数据时,显示输入参数过多时。
      解决办法:应重新导入,将格式选择为数值矩阵或列矢量进行导入。
    • 报错:无法打开电子表格,MATLAB报告了以下错误;错误:服务器出现意外情况。
      解决办法:此时应重新设置Excel的COM加载项,去掉所有的Add-in加载项。
    • 报错:错误使用savefig, H必须是有效图
      解决办法:重新保存一次图片。
    展开全文
  • 如何用Matlab把excel表格中的数据导入Matlab中并绘制出图?   1.将excel中的数据导入Matlab中,点击“导入数据” 2.弹出“Import”窗口,在窗口工具栏左侧导入选项中选择“Matrix(矩阵)”,然后点击工具栏...

    如何用Matlab把excel表格中的数据导入Matlab中并绘制出图?

     

    1.将excel中的数据导入Matlab中,点击“导入数据”

    2.弹出“Import”窗口,在窗口工具栏左侧导入选项中选择“Matrix(矩阵)”,然后点击工具栏右侧的“勾”,导入数据。

    3.关闭“Import”窗口,回到MATLAB主程序,在WorkSpace(工作空间)中可以看到刚刚导入矩阵变量,接下来就可以对矩阵进行运算了。

    4.点击绘图就会出现各种绘图方式,比如选择第一个:

    展开全文
  • 在使用MATLAB对矩阵...将Excel数据导入MATLAB中的步骤将待导入的矩阵结构的数据录入Excel中,录入时注意行列要跟原矩阵一一对应将Excel数据导入MATLAB中的步骤图1录入完以后保存数据,为了后续步骤使用方便,命名...

    在使用MATLAB对矩阵进行数据处理时,为了方便编辑与修改,常常需要先将数据录入到Excel中,然后再将其导入到MATLAB中参与矩阵运算。那么下面小编教你怎么将Excel数据导入MATLAB中。

    将Excel数据导入MATLAB中的步骤

    将待导入的矩阵结构的数据录入Excel中,录入时注意行列要跟原矩阵一一对应

    b78119072c57f935fbd77380cf05190c.png

    将Excel数据导入MATLAB中的步骤图1

    录入完以后保存数据,为了后续步骤使用方便,命名时我们最好把它命名为我们接下来在MATLAB中要引用的变量名(比如在MATLAB中要将该矩阵作为B矩阵参与运算,就可以把它命名为B.xls,xls为文件扩展名)

    01ae00e6b21a0450a1dec462e3666a35.png

    将Excel数据导入MATLAB中的步骤图2

    运行MATLAB程序,点击工具栏上的Import Data工具按钮

    708f429ca4c7829218c58968f9b70a14.png

    将Excel数据导入MATLAB中的步骤图3

    在弹出的“Import Data”对话框中找到前面保存的数据文件(B.xls),“打开”

    b7d3eb78b1c5ce9c2b0e8cc98347cb4a.png

    将Excel数据导入MATLAB中的步骤图4

    弹出“Import”窗口,在窗口工具栏左侧导入选项中选择“Matrix(矩阵)”,然后点击工具栏右侧的“勾”,导入数据

    66ae8c418fc1e0b8513a62674d82e9a3.png

    将Excel数据导入MATLAB中的步骤图5

    关闭“Import”窗口,回到MATLAB主程序,在WorkSpace(工作空间)中可以看到刚刚导入矩阵变量,接下来就可以对矩阵进行运算了

    33ec0efd36ef388f0ca6f6f095c0d6db.png

    将Excel数据导入MATLAB中的步骤图6

    每次关闭MATLAB程序都会将工作空间中的变量清空,所以如果经常用到该变量,不妨将该变量保存为MAT文件

    964c1ef89707cac2e676ed3b30f3d272.png

    将Excel数据导入MATLAB中的步骤图7

    0f55ffc6ac51d8afa9e56837d4b00e6d.png

    将Excel数据导入MATLAB中的步骤图8

    这样一来每次打开MATLAB,只需要双击MAT文件便可以将变量导入工作空间

    7a1c671bb7b589d50ec9a808a1299f18.png

    将Excel数据导入MATLAB中的步骤图9

    猜你喜欢:

    展开全文
  • Execl数据导入Matlab数据处理中的常见问题,通常为字符串和数值两种数据,在导入和处理中有些许区别。 注意:本程序适用与Matlab 2016b以后版本 通用版本适用xlsread函数: [num,txt,raw]=xlsread('C:\Users\Hong\...

    Execl数据导入是Matlab数据处理中的常见问题,通常为字符串和数值两种数据,在导入和处理中有些许区别。

    注意:本程序适用于Matlab 2016b以后版本

    通用版本适用xlsread函数:

    [num,txt,raw]=xlsread('C:\Users\Hong\Desktop\matlab\其他类型仿真\ares1.xls');%表格路径
    c=readcell('C:\Users\Hong\Desktop\matlab\其他类型仿真\ares1.xls');
    

    这样读取num值为表格中的数值变量,txt为字符串数据,raw为读取全部的表格数据和字符串数据组成的胞元数组(Cell),胞元数组与数值数组的定义和使用方式有区别,胞元数组是由各种不同类型的数据组合起来的数组,举例为A={‘a’,1,2,‘First’},需要使用花括号来构成胞元数组,数组取值时与数值数组同理使用B=A{1,1}这种定义。

    2016b以后版本使用readcell, readmatrix,readtable函数

    先说好处,旧语法对格式没问题的Excel文件读取的结果差不多,但readcell对读取txt和部分数据缺失的Excel文件可以自动整理,使用opt导入选项可以对数据导入过程进行控制。

    对应xlsread的使用效果
    readcell=raw
    readmatrix=num
    在这里插入图片描述
    在这里插入图片描述

    高级用法为 readtable 可以基于格式导入数据,自动进行行列的命名操作。相较于xlsread更加合理。
    'ReadVariableNames’为读取第一行作为变量名称
    'ReadRowNames’为读取第一列作为行名称的指示符
    ‘TreatAsEmpty’作为空值处理的占位符文本默认为’NaN’
    ‘TextType’导入文本的数据类型 默认为’Char’
    'DatetimeType’导入日期和时间数据的类型
    'Encoding’字符编码方案默认为UTF-8类型

    z=readtable('C:\Users\Hong\Desktop\matlab\其他类型仿真\ares1.xls','ReadRowNames',true);
    

    在这里插入图片描述
    Copyright © 2020 by RichardYang. All rights reserved.
    仅供参考,严禁转载,感谢。

    展开全文
  • Matlab编程技巧:导入Excel表格数据

    千次阅读 2019-12-21 21:15:08
    在MBD(基于模型的设计)开发中,经常需要用matlab读取表格中的数据进行处理。因此,本文专门研究了一下matlab语言中用于处理Excel表格的函数,总结其用法、输入输出变量以及它们的适用场景。 1 函数 常用的读取...
  • MATLAB导入EXCEL表格数据画散点图

    千次阅读 2020-05-11 09:21:10
    在处理一些实验数据时,通常要画散点图,本来EXCEL自带的散点图功能也很好,但是为了秀一下,我们也要用到MATLAB来画图,下面来介绍一下实现方法。 如果你第一次使用MATLAB,那就要从头开始介绍了。 首先来新建一个...
  • Matlab中怎么读入数据 Matlab中怎么导入大量数据 可以把大量的数据存入文本文档和excel表格 Matlab中怎么读入图片 I=imread'F:\Matlab\shibie\1.jpg; 思考解答 Matlab中怎么输出数据 Matlab中怎么输出数据 Matlab中...
  • matlab导入excel表格数据并进行动态画图

    千次阅读 多人点赞 2019-10-24 19:55:37
    国家统计局下载1949-2018年的GDP与人口数据,存入excel中,通过matlab实现数据动态绘图。 程序显示 data=xlsread("C:\Users\1\Desktop\人口+GDP.xlsx");%excel文档的绝对路径 x=1949; y1=data(1,2); y2=data(1,3); ...
  • MATLAB导入数据

    千次阅读 2020-10-11 21:54:19
    如果双击文本文件或者电子表格,则会出现数据的预览,其中要导入数据以蓝色突出显示,文本文件中的任何缺失的数据以橙色突出显示,且默认情况下将被替换为NaN,表示非数值。默认情况下,导入工具以表的形式导入...
  • 初学数学建模,很崩溃,好多不会。模拟题要求处理几万的数据,吓死人…那个时候excel与MATLAB都不会用。之前我一直认为excel只是一个表格????,真的没想到excel的用法有很多,而且超级简便。 之前做了个 ...
  • 该函数提供了一种简单的方法,可以将打开的文档电子表格的内容加载到 MATLAB 中。... 另外,我认为可以实现一种类似的方法来允许人们将数据MATLAB 导出到开放文档电子表格中。 基于 Alex Marten 方法。
  • matlab从xls导入数据

    2018-04-30 20:22:49
    xx = xlsread('G:\gongbao.xlsx','two','D2:...参数分别为 表格路径,工作表名称(sheet),范围matlab从xls中逆序取数据:行向量就用fliplr函数 列向量就用flipud函数。如 x=[1 2 3 4 5];  fliplr(x) ans =54321...
  • matlab中的矩阵数据导入到csv表格

    千次阅读 2019-03-18 20:52:43
    %创建csv表格 writetable(result_table, 'teat_result3.csv') ---------------------  作者:我是谁_谁是我  来源:CSDN  原文:https://blog.csdn.net/wcx1293296315/article/details/85012987  版权声明...
  • matlab中如何导入excel数据

    万次阅读 2017-11-16 17:32:32
     无法打开电子表格MATLAB报告以下错误:服务器出现意外情况的解决方案 应该是在Excel选项中->加载项,在对话框的最下面有个管理,选到com加载项,点击转到
  • Clipboard2WorkSpace 是一个脚本,用于从剪贴板导入表格数据(例如来自 Excel 表格的数据) ******************************** 添加一名作者创建日期:01/06/2019 ********************************
  • 1.使用串口将多路传感器数据导入csv表格 逗号分隔值(Comma-Separated Values,CSV,有时也称为字符分隔值,因为分隔字符也可以不是逗号)。通过在打印文本的时候加入“ ,”或者“ /r/n ”可以实现换列和换行。 ...
  • MATLAB导入数据Excel数据并做出散点图
  • 该项目包含MATLAB函数,用于将互联网来源的历史小时气象观测值作为表格导入MATLAB中。 原始数据源是<>的Weather Underground。 但是,Weather Underground经历了所有权变更,现在需要付费订阅才能访问其大部分...
  • MATLAB导入和导出Excel数据

    千次阅读 2020-12-11 00:00:46
    MATLAB 中有时候需要用到外部的数据进行仿真计算,或者有时需要把 MATLAB 中的数据导出到外部表格,这就用到 Excel 与 MATLAB 之间的命令函数。 2 导入 A=xlsread('xxx.xlsx') # xxx 为文件名称 其中,由于 xxx...
  • matlab:Excel文件数据导入及导出

    万次阅读 多人点赞 2015-08-14 10:51:58
    前言因为这段时间在用matlab处理数据,把Excel表格数据导入matlab中然后进行相关的处理,不得不说还是很方便的,如果一个数据一个数据的修改或者输入就太不应该了,这里我就简单说明一下怎么导入及修改。...
  • MATLAB 脚本,可用于在从 RSA6100A 实时频谱分析仪提取的频谱轨迹上... 可定义的参数- 开始频率- 停止频率- RBW - 跟踪平均值的数量- 噪音本底的峰值游览输出-频谱轨迹图,峰值编号- MATLAB 命令窗口中峰值的表格输出
  • 第四届泰迪杯数据挖掘挑战赛B题数据预处理-数据导入Matlab) 1数据结构分析 我这次的目的是读取一个月的梯形密度表数据, 按照(日期, 车次, 车站, 上车人数)的数据库表格式保存在元胞数组中。所以拿到“旅客...
  • 如上图所示,将图一中的数据读取到uitable中,另外在运行时,如何动态的给uitable添加表格,例如:已知点点号图2中有3行,但是我下一组需要4行,在程序运行状态下,如何让他再可以继续生成新的行。 希望大佬们给予...
  • 一个excel表格中可能有一个Sheet或多个Sheet,虽然在MATLAB中只需要加些代码即可轻松实现,但是为了帮助各位更容易理解。因此,分为两部分讲解:1)excel表格中只有一个Sheet;2)excel表格中只有多个Sheet。 一 ...
  • Matlab 导入Excel表数据的方法

    千次阅读 2020-09-14 21:13:08
    导入 Excel 表数据的方法 1. 使用 UI 界面中的 导入数据 功能。 2. 在工作区直接导入复制的 Excel 内容 ...n 取大于 0 的数字,表示读取 sheet n 的所有表格,不写 n 的时候会取 sheet 1 的所有数据。 函数
  • Excel数据导入matlab命令xlsread()

    千次阅读 2019-08-14 19:45:59
    例如: EEE= xlsread('Excel.xlsx','sheet1','B3:B9'); 命令中分别代表该Excel的名字,工作簿的选择,已经范围的选择。 注意:使用前要将该表格matlab程序所在目录中。 ...
  • PREVAH 水文模型使用二进制格式的网格数据,可以使用这些脚本读取和写入... 此外,可以读取表格 ascii 格式的输入和结果数据。 在此处查找有关 PREVAH 模型的信息: http://www.hydrologie.unibe.ch/PREVAH/index.htm
  • 1,先导入到工作空间。 点击示波器设置按钮,按照下图设置即可保存到工作空间。 保 存成功后在运行一次 2.把工作空间中的数值保存到Excle中并存入磁盘。 xlswrite('D:\write2Excel.xls',data,'data1');%...
  • MATLAB生成excel表格

    万次阅读 多人点赞 2018-11-13 18:26:00
    利用excel对数据进行复杂处理有一定局限性,于是选择导入MATLAB进行处理。此贴针对MATLAB数据导出至excel,列举一些简单的例子,帮助大家学习。

空空如也

空空如也

1 2 3 4 5 ... 9
收藏数 166
精华内容 66
关键字:

matlab表格数据导入

matlab 订阅